ReThink Waste at the Library is offering free one-hour workshops to help people avoid, reduce, reuse and recycle waste. Each session focuses on a different topic and ties in with the seasons.
This series is a great chance for our community to learn more about waste, recycling and sustainability, while meeting others who care about making a positive impact.
At the upcoming session, you’ll learn Furoshiki – a beautiful Japanese fabric-wrapping technique – and make your own gift tags. It’s a creative, zero-waste way to make your Christmas presents extra special and spark conversations about reducing holiday waste.
